createCachingMiddleware
createCachingMiddleware(
config):Middleware
Defined in: packages/middleware/src/caching.ts:260
Create caching middleware.
Caches responses with TTL-based expiration and LRU eviction.
Parameters
Section titled “Parameters”config
Section titled “config”CachingConfig = {}
Caching configuration
Returns
Section titled “Returns”Caching middleware
Example
Section titled “Example”const caching = createCachingMiddleware({ ttl: 3600000, // 1 hour maxSize: 1000, cacheStreaming: false});
bridge.use(caching);